Transaction 22883139631f77bf4eb711fd93b8a49727cfb244cfc246e73fa0ccd890bafa52
1 Input
2 Outputs
- 22883139631f77bf4eb711fd93b8a49727cfb244cfc246e73fa0ccd890bafa52:0
- 22883139631f77bf4eb711fd93b8a49727cfb244cfc246e73fa0ccd890bafa52:1
value 17043
address 1DByQ6TK5qNMceLotqw9qb36w8mCZXievU
value 174099
address 1M3VRy3mzshNh8hkhEuwTp8EP2igCiSVw7